A Cygwin user has requested that emacs have mouse support on Cygwin even
if it is built --with-x=no. Does anyone see a problem with this? If
not, what's the best way to do it? Here's one possibility:
=== modified file 'configure.ac'
--- configure.ac 2012-10-06 00:44:36 +0000
+++ configure.ac 2012-10-07 01:53:21 +0000
@@ -4358,6 +4358,11 @@
AC_SUBST(WINDOW_SYSTEM_OBJ)
+## Always build with mouse support on Cygwin
+if test "$opsys" = "cygwin" && test "$window_system" = "none"; then
+ AC_DEFINE(HAVE_MOUSE, 1, [Define if you have mouse support.])
+fi
+
